ruger super redhawk
A double-action revolver line introduced by Sturm, Ruger and Company in 1987. The Super Redhawk is a large, heavily built revolver, usually long-barreled and visually identifiable by its distinctive frame, which extends for some distance along the barrel in front of the cylinder to support an integrated mounting system for a telescopic sight. Originally available only in .44 Magnum, it has since been offered in other large-bore cartridges, such as .454 Casull and .480 Ruger, as well as 10mm Auto. It is only made in stainless steel.
